Epson has unveiled the latest addition to its SureColor SC-P series, the 1.62m-wide (64in) SC-P20000. The machine, which prints at speeds of up to 17.5sqm/hr, is designed for commercial printers, copy shops, photo labs and high street photo outlets. It can be used to produce high-quality large-format POS, short-term outdoor and interior signage, exhibition and display graphics, promotional graphics and photographs. The device will be shown at Fespa Digital in Amsterdam from 8th to 11th March and will be commercially available the same month. Pricing is yet to be confirmed.

The machine comes with a permanent PrecisionCore MicroTFP printhead that produces print up to a 2,400x1,200dpi resolution.

This is coupled with high-precision media feed technology, including a newly developed camera-based paper feed stabiliser and media inductive roller system, to ensure the printer operates smoothly even when unattended. The SC-P range, which was launched last September, also includes the SC-P6000, SC-P7000, SC-P8000 and SC-P9000 inkjet printers, which are available in 61cm  and 1.12m widths. Epson said the SC-P20000 is a “significantly superior successor” to the Stylus Pro 11880, which this machine will replace.

Other features of the device include a new Epson UltraChrome Pro 10-colour inkset. Epson said blacks will be deep and rich thanks to new high density Photo and Matte Black inks while better gradation with reduced graininess can be achieved due to the inkset containing four shades of black ink, and Multi Size Droplet Technology (MSDT).

Additionally, a new printhead structure means fewer vibrations and more accurate ink droplets and dot placement. The Epson Colour Calibration utility allows users to easily manage their colour reproduction and maintain consistency.
